Here are some key insights into how these two domains interact:

  • Stress and Health:

    Financial strain is a leading cause of stress, which can manifest in various health issues, including anxiety, depression, and even physical ailments like headaches and digestive problems. When money stress becomes overwhelming, it often leads to unhealthy coping mechanisms, such as overeating or neglecting exercise.

  • Access to Healthy Choices:

    Financial stability can provide the means to access healthier food options and wellness activities. Those with limited resources may find it challenging to prioritize organic produce or holistic health services. Healthier choices typically come at a premium, making it crucial to budget wisely to include these in your life.

  • Preventive Healthcare:

Investing in preventive healthcare can save you money in the long run. Regular check-ups, screenings, and healthy lifestyle choices can prevent chronic illnesses that often require expensive treatments. Establishing a budget that allocates funds for proactive health measures can reduce future healthcare costs.

  • Mindful Spending:

Much like a healthy diet, a mindful approach to spending encourages balance. Consider how you allocate your finances—spending on experiences that promote wellbeing can be just as vital as having a nutritious meal. Investing in art therapy, wellness books, or holistic health services can enhance your mental and emotional health, thus creating a cycle of positivity.

  • Lifestyle Adjustments:

As you gain awareness of your financial habits, making conscious lifestyle adjustments can yield both health and financial benefits. Cooking at home rather than dining out can save money and allow you to control ingredient quality, making it easier to adhere to a gluten-free or holistic diet.
